Distance 125 km
I dont usually see Western tourist couples with their kid out in these rigs
The Mae Sariang river appears to have slightly more water than the Yuam right now
Out of town and both rivers have merged by now so a slightly better flow
All thats flowing south as I ride over it at Sop Moei
High up on the 3004 and still a flow here
The view from the viewpoint at the top of the 3004
A mixed blessing is the 3004 now that its finished, the dirt section was great at the end of the rainy season but this time of the year was horrible with losts of bulldust from the heavy volume of traffic and is therefore a lot nicer to ride right now
I ride it to the end of the paved section south of Le Kho then back track to Le Kho to do the dirt loop
I mainly wished I hadnt bothered, the bulldust is non stop
A short concrete section under the bulldust which goes towards a village but I turn off earlier, I am wondering if they will concrete from Le Kho all the way here soon
The tractors has been through here and it was a loose surface pretty much the whole way
Still a small flow into the Yuam
The Yuam and it looks a lot deeper on the other side
The Mae Lit and Mae Ngao rivers have added their volume to the Yuam between here and Sop Moei and its a much stronger flow
